— What You Can Expect —

At the Grimsel mountain pass, embark on an unforgettable canyoning adventure perfect for both experienced canyoneers and sporty beginners. This guided water experience in a dramatic alpine setting begins with a breathtaking 50-meter abseil into the gorge.

The Grimsel canyon offers a series of exciting natural obstacles, including water slides, crystal-clear pools, waterfalls, and jumps of varying heights from 4 to 8 meters. Most challenges can be attempted according to your comfort level, with the exception of the mandatory 50-meter rappel at the start. The gorge is as impressive for its wild beauty and striking rock formations as it is for the adventure it provides.

Your experience begins with pickup from a designated location and transfer to the base in Matten near Interlaken, where you’ll gear up with your guide. After about an hour’s drive to Grimsel Pass, you’ll receive a detailed safety briefing and instruction on key canyoning techniques.

The adventure continues for 2 to 2.5 hours inside the gorge, combining action, nature, and adrenaline. At the end of your tour, enjoy a refreshing drink and light snack before returning to Interlaken.

5. What kind of natural environment will I encounter during the Grimsel Canyoning trip?

During the Grimsel Canyoning trip, you will explore the spectacular Grimsel Gorge, an ancient granite chasm shaped by glacial activity. The environment features dramatic waterfalls, natural rock slides, and crystal-clear glacial pools. You'll navigate through stunning rock formations and lush alpine vegetation, offering breathtaking views and an immersive connection with the raw, untouched beauty of the Swiss Alps.
